Honeymoon hotel / Hester Browne.
Events planner Rosie McDonald has never met a to-do list she couldn't conquer or a Bridezilla she couldn't declaw. Her impeccably organized weddings are putting London's once-fashionable Bonneville Hotel back on the map. Though Rosie makes magic happen for other couples, she opts for a more pragmatic relationship with her food critic boyfriend, while working tirelessly toward a coveted promotion. Cue the return of her boss's free-spirited son, Joe, who's been brought in to learn the family business. Joe's approach is more board shorts than black tie. There's talk of bouncy castles in the Bonneville courtyard. Dancing down the aisle. Even (shudder) <i>buffets.</i> Soon, Rosie's sophisticated plans for a lavish supermodel wedding are crumbling like week-old croquembouche. Her career, the hotel's reputation, and her relationship look likely to follow suit. But amid the chaos, Rosie is starting to see her world of clipboards and checked boxes in a new light. For so long, Rosie has been chasing perfect. What might happen if, just once, she decided to pursue happy instead?
